Mark Mickey, the co-owner of Pavona's Pizza Joint in Akron, Ohio, pleaded guilty to arson on last week, according to a News 5 report.
Mickey, who was originally charged with fourth-degree felony arson in February 2023, had initially pleaded not guilty.
The fire, which broke out in October 2022, destroyed the pizza shop located on Sand Run Road. The flames also engulfed Mickey's Irish Pub, located next door and owned by Mickey's wife, Courtney Pavona.
Akron officials said it took more than five hours to extinguish the fire, which used over 2.5 million gallons of water. Investigators determined the origin of the fire was under the staircase in the pizza shop.
